Liberty 04-09...... Mcintosh 13 speaker
After much searching for a local replacement to my rear 8" speaker after the ring rotted out i have found a pop in replacement at soundlabs....
http://www.soundlabsgroup.com.au/p/V-90 ... 00+-+4+Ohm
Needs a 10mm spacer but all else lines up and 50/80watt rating it won't stress the amp replacing the 35/70 mcintosh unit.
Postage 2/3rds price but cheap enough all round. Got mine $68 delivered to gold coast

I didn't want to upgrade the family car with big bucks but the rear speaker is a must to fill out the sound imho....
